During neuronal development and maturation, microRNAs (miRs) play diverse functions
ranging from early patterning, proliferation and commitment to differentiation, survival,
homeostasis, activity and plasticity of more mature and adult neurons. The role of miRs in
the differentiation of olfactory receptor neurons (ORNs) is emerging from the conditional
inactivation of Dicer in immature ORN, and the depletion of all mature miRs in this system.
